Multiple Approaches Necessary to Combat Growing Social Problem
ENOLA, Pa. -- CyberPatrol LLC announced today its strong support for Assembly Bill 86, which would give California school officials new tools to battle cyberbullying and increase online safety for the millions of students in the country's largest public school system. Cyberbullying refers to the use of the Internet to harass and stigmatize students and others.
